With Pedro being up for HOF next year, it got me to thinking about the '94 Expos team that got denied a chance at History by the strike...

What's the best team you saw that DID NOT win that season's World Series?

3 of my Favorites at the time all lost in the Playoffs despite being GREAT teams:

The '88 Mets who lost to Orel and the Dodgers. The '90 Oakland A's, who lost to Billy Hatcher and the Reds.

And the '09 or '10 Phils, who both were better than the '08 Champs IMO...

2001 Seattle Mariners dominated the league that year.. 116 wins and one of the main reasons Lou Pinella left..

He asked the front office to get David Justice and they said no.. Then Justice had the knockout blow that let NY advance to the World Series..

1984 Chicago Cubs

They just could not lose that year and won the first two games of the playoffs (only one round of playoffs then) and were one win away from the World Series but the dang Padres and Steve Garvey somehow found their groove and kicked their tails. This one still hurts because as a member of the front office that year I would have had a World Series ring if they won.
